暗号資産(仮想通貨)の安全性を高める方法紹介



暗号資産(仮想通貨)の安全性を高める方法紹介


暗号資産(仮想通貨)の安全性を高める方法紹介

暗号資産(仮想通貨)は、その分散性と匿名性から、従来の金融システムとは異なる魅力を持つ一方で、セキュリティ上のリスクも伴います。近年、取引所からのハッキングや詐欺事件が多発しており、資産を安全に管理するための知識と対策が不可欠となっています。本稿では、暗号資産の安全性を高めるための様々な方法について、技術的な側面から運用上の注意点まで、詳細に解説します。

1. 暗号資産の基礎知識とリスク

暗号資産の安全性を理解するためには、まずその基礎知識と潜在的なリスクを把握する必要があります。

1.1 暗号資産の仕組み

暗号資産は、暗号技術を用いて取引の安全性を確保し、中央機関に依存しない分散型のシステムで運用されます。ブロックチェーンと呼ばれる分散型台帳技術がその基盤であり、取引履歴は暗号化されてネットワーク全体に記録されます。これにより、改ざんが極めて困難になり、高い信頼性が確保されます。

1.2 暗号資産のリスク

暗号資産には、以下のようなリスクが存在します。

  • 取引所リスク: 取引所がハッキングされた場合、預けていた暗号資産が盗まれる可能性があります。
  • ウォレットリスク: ウォレットの秘密鍵が漏洩した場合、暗号資産が不正に引き出される可能性があります。
  • 詐欺リスク: 偽のICO(Initial Coin Offering)やフィッシング詐欺など、様々な詐欺の手口が存在します。
  • 価格変動リスク: 暗号資産の価格は非常に変動しやすく、短期間で大幅な損失を被る可能性があります。
  • 技術的リスク: ブロックチェーン技術自体に脆弱性が見つかる可能性や、スマートコントラクトのバグなどが存在します。

2. ウォレットの選択と管理

暗号資産の保管方法であるウォレットの選択と管理は、セキュリティにおいて最も重要な要素の一つです。ウォレットには、大きく分けて以下の種類があります。

2.1 ハードウェアウォレット

ハードウェアウォレットは、USBメモリのような形状をした物理的なデバイスで、秘密鍵をオフラインで保管します。インターネットに接続されないため、ハッキングのリスクを大幅に軽減できます。LedgerやTrezorなどが代表的なハードウェアウォレットです。

2.2 ソフトウェアウォレット

ソフトウェアウォレットは、パソコンやスマートフォンにインストールするアプリケーションで、秘密鍵をオンラインで保管します。利便性が高い一方で、マルウェア感染やフィッシング詐欺のリスクがあります。ExodusやElectrumなどが代表的なソフトウェアウォレットです。

2.3 ウェブウォレット

ウェブウォレットは、ウェブブラウザ上で利用できるウォレットで、秘密鍵を取引所のサーバー上に保管します。最も利便性が高い一方で、取引所がハッキングされた場合のリスクが最も高くなります。CoinbaseやBinanceなどが代表的なウェブウォレットを提供しています。

2.4 ウォレット管理の注意点

  • 秘密鍵の厳重な保管: 秘密鍵は絶対に他人に教えないこと。紙に書き写して厳重に保管するか、ハードウェアウォレットを使用することを推奨します。
  • バックアップの作成: ウォレットのバックアップを作成し、紛失や破損に備えること。
  • 二段階認証の設定: ウォレットや取引所に二段階認証を設定し、不正アクセスを防止すること。
  • ソフトウェアのアップデート: ウォレットやOSのソフトウェアを常に最新の状態に保ち、セキュリティ脆弱性を解消すること。

3. 取引所の選択と利用

暗号資産の取引を行う際には、信頼できる取引所を選択し、安全に利用することが重要です。

3.1 取引所のセキュリティ対策

取引所がどのようなセキュリティ対策を講じているかを確認することが重要です。以下のような点に注目しましょう。

  • コールドウォレットの利用: 顧客の資産の大部分をオフラインで保管するコールドウォレットを利用しているか。
  • 二段階認証の導入: 二段階認証を導入しているか。
  • セキュリティ監査の実施: 定期的に第三者機関によるセキュリティ監査を実施しているか。
  • 保険の加入: ハッキング被害に備えて保険に加入しているか。

3.2 取引所の利用上の注意点

  • 少額からの取引: 最初は少額から取引を始め、取引所の信頼性を確認すること。
  • APIキーの管理: APIキーを利用する際には、権限を最小限に抑え、定期的に変更すること。
  • フィッシング詐欺への注意: 偽の取引所サイトやメールに注意し、安易に個人情報を入力しないこと。

4. スマートコントラクトのセキュリティ

スマートコントラクトは、ブロックチェーン上で自動的に実行されるプログラムであり、DeFi(分散型金融)などの分野で広く利用されています。しかし、スマートコントラクトにはバグが含まれる可能性があり、ハッキングのリスクがあります。

4.1 スマートコントラクトの脆弱性

スマートコントラクトの脆弱性には、以下のようなものがあります。

  • 再入可能性攻撃: 攻撃者がスマートコントラクトの関数を繰り返し呼び出し、資金を不正に引き出す攻撃。
  • オーバーフロー/アンダーフロー: 数値演算の結果が、変数の範囲を超えてしまう問題。
  • フロントランニング: 攻撃者が取引の情報を事前に知り、有利な取引を行う攻撃。

4.2 スマートコントラクトのセキュリティ対策

  • 監査の実施: スマートコントラクトのコードを専門家による監査を受け、脆弱性を発見すること。
  • 形式検証の利用: スマートコントラクトのコードが仕様通りに動作することを数学的に証明する形式検証を利用すること。
  • バグバウンティプログラムの実施: 脆弱性を発見した人に報酬を与えるバグバウンティプログラムを実施すること。

5. その他のセキュリティ対策

上記以外にも、暗号資産の安全性を高めるための様々な対策があります。

5.1 VPNの利用

VPN(Virtual Private Network)を利用することで、インターネット接続を暗号化し、IPアドレスを隠蔽することができます。これにより、ハッキングや監視のリスクを軽減できます。

5.2 強固なパスワードの設定

推測されにくい強固なパスワードを設定し、定期的に変更することが重要です。パスワードマネージャーを利用すると、安全にパスワードを管理できます。

5.3 最新のセキュリティソフトの導入

パソコンやスマートフォンに最新のセキュリティソフトを導入し、マルウェア感染を防止することが重要です。

5.4 情報収集と学習

暗号資産に関する最新の情報を収集し、セキュリティに関する知識を深めることが重要です。信頼できる情報源から情報を得るように心がけましょう。

まとめ

暗号資産の安全性は、技術的な対策だけでなく、運用上の注意点も重要です。ウォレットの選択と管理、取引所の選択と利用、スマートコントラクトのセキュリティ、その他のセキュリティ対策を総合的に実施することで、暗号資産を安全に管理することができます。常に最新の情報を収集し、セキュリティ意識を高めることが、暗号資産を安全に利用するための鍵となります。暗号資産は、その可能性を秘めた一方で、リスクも伴うことを理解し、慎重に利用することが重要です。


前の記事

スイ(SUI)の人気機能ランキングTOP

次の記事

暗号資産(仮想通貨)を使った資産形成プラン例